What is new hire reporting used for?
What is New Hire reporting? New Hire reporting is a process by which you, as an employer, report information on newly hired employees to a designated state agency shortly after the date of hire. As an employer, you play a key role in this important program by reporting all your newly hired employees to your state.
What forms need to be filled out for a new employee in Wisconsin?
WHO MUST COMPLETE: Effective on or after January 1, 2020, every newly‑hired employee is required to provide a completed Form WT‑4 to each of their employers. Form WT‑4 will be used by your employer to determine the amount of Wisconsin income tax to be withheld from your paychecks.

What two conditions require an employer to file a copy of an employee WT-4 with the Department of WI?
If employees claim more than 10 exemptions or claim complete exemption from withholding and earn more than $200 per week, employers are required to mail a copy of their Form WT-4 to the Wisconsin Department of Revenue (DOR).

Is Wisconsin an at will employment state?
Wisconsin is an employment at will state, meaning employers and employees in the private sector have the right to terminate an employment relationship at any time and without reason. There are exceptions to employment at will, including that employers cannot fire employees for illegal reasons.
